What problem does it solve?

This Skill addresses issues with audio playback in Godot, such as SFX being cut off during rapid triggers, inconsistent bus routing, and jarring music transitions.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Stable SFX Playback: Ensures sound effects are not cut off even under high-frequency triggers by using pooling and polyphony limits.
  • Reliable Music Transitions: Implements deterministic crossfade behavior for smooth music changes.
  • Bus Routing Policy: Enforces explicit routing of audio players to defined buses (e.g., SFX, Music, UI) for consistent volume and effects.
  • Use Case: Prevent critical game sound effects from being lost during intense action sequences and ensure background music fades smoothly between levels.
